Maps are everywhere in the brain...and finally we've discovered one in the nose! Led by @davidhbrann.bsky.social, we uncovered the logic that specifies the positions of each of the 1,000 sensory neuron subtypes in the nose and aligns their projections to the brain.👇👃see more details below👃👇

Thought problem: If you could deeply phenotype a whole brain - mapping all ultrastructure and connectivity, plus in situ proteomics, metabolomics and transcriptomics - would that be sufficient to constrain a model of its function under all conditions? What's the minimal data needed for emulation?

The Physics Nobel winners this year, who got the prize for AI, are all NIH-funded brain researchers. They’re #NeuroAI people. Brain science and AI have had a lot of crossover. Dismantling NIH will without question harm AI.
